Vince Gill & Friends On The Road

Vince Gill has planned a brief excursion in March with Ashley Monroe, Charlie Worsham and daughter Jenny Gill called “Vince Gill & Friends.” But don’t be fooled by the tour’s name – just because the singer/songwriter’s name is listed first, he’s not the headliner.

All four acts will be on stage for the entire show.

“This won’t be a ‘guitar pull, where one person sings while the others listen and wait for their turn,” Gill says. “We’ll all be pitching in, picking and singing harmony for each other and doing each other’s songs. It will be a musical collaboration – not a headliner with opening acts.”

Gill is no stranger to working with other acts, having appeared as a guest artist on nearly 1,000 albums.

His most recent album is 2013’s Bakersfield, which he made with steel guitar player Paul Franklin. The LP is filled with tunes from the creators of the “Bakersfield Sound” – Merle Haggard and Buck Owens.

Worsham released his debut, Rubberband, in 2013. The LP just so happens to include an appearance by Gill.

Monroe is once again having Gill produce her upcoming album. In addition to working as the executive producer on 2013’s Like a Rose, Gill also co-wrote two of the tracks.
